Duration
If the function selected is a transition, configure the duration here in Milliseconds
Input
If the function controls a particular Input, select it here.
You can also tick Assign Shortcut to Input Number so this shortcut will always
control any input assigned to a particular Number, otherwise the shortcut will
control the same input even if it has been moved.
Title, Description1, Description2
Assign some optional text to uniquely identify your shortcut when it is displayed in the Web Controller
Display
Configure the display options when showing this shortcut in the Web Controller.
Default: The standard button with text.
Colour: Customise the background colour of the standard button with text.
Image: Select a custom image file to display in place of the button. The image will be stretched to fit the
button dimensions.
Thumbnail: Display a thumbnail preview of the Input's contents at the time when the Web Controller page
was last refreshed.
(Note: This is not a live thumbnail preview, but the latest image can be downloaded by refreshing the page in
the web browser).
